Founded in 2006, SurveyGizmo is a powerful survey and data insights platform that empowers business professionals to make informed decisions. As SaaS application software, it offers user-friendly data collection tools for understanding customers, markets, and employees in real time and communicating this information across an organization. It provides data insights in over 205 countries, with 50K new surveys created and 5M responses collected every week.

What You’ll Do

We are looking for a Senior Information Systems Administrator to join our team! This position will work as part of a growing collaborative enterprise information systems team to ensure maximum efficiently of our enterprise processes and systems that support critical sales and finance functions. In this position, you will:

  • Design, document, develop, and maintain new solutions that enable the growth of the company through gained efficiencies and access to critical operational data
  • Develop and document enterprise system architecture, data flows, and integrations
  • Ensure accurate and actionable data is in the appropriate system of record and easily accessible though dashboards or reports you help to develop
  • Work closely with a passionate group of stakeholders to make a dramatic impact on the growth of the business

How you’ll spend your days:

  • Performing administration functions in key IS systems (Salesforce, Zuora, Hubspot), including managing user profiles, roles, permissions, record types, objects, reports, dashboards, and incident support
  • Developing custom fields, page layouts, record types, reports, objects and dashboards
  • Performing data imports, exports and updates
  • Assisting users with best practices and process optimization opportunities - you see what others can’t see
  • Partnering with leadership, external development teams and suppliers to ensure timely, accurate, and cost-effective delivery of solutions
  • Taking a leadership role in grooming, development, testing, and deployment of projects
  • Developing documentation, training materials, workflows, and process maps to increase knowledge throughout the organization
  • Build and maintain data integration tools (ETLs) and ensure data integrity is monitored and maintained between key systems
  • Support and develop custom solutions using APEX scripting, process builder, workflows, etc.
  • Collaborate with outside contractors to deliver on key IS initiatives
  • Design and develop dashboards and reports for business stakeholders
  • Develop and document enterprise system architecture, data flows and integrations
